T ucked away on a quiet pedestrian-only cobblestone street, boutique hotel La Valise San Miguel is an ode to surrealism. Luxury hotelier Yves Naman purchased and fell in love with property in 2017 after seeing its stunning installations by Mexican artist and designer Pedro Friedeberg scattered throughout the neutral stucco interiors. The courtyard garden — with reflecting pools and lush greenery, and a trippy Friedeberg mural — is a calming oasis. Six suites overlook the courtyard and include baths with opulent soaking tubs, fireplaces, and Pedro Friedeberg-inspired plasterwork. lavalisesma.com. The original 1860s complex, partially designed by architect Henry Howard, has since been revitalized by hotel group ASH NYC and architecture firm studioWTA. The interiors pay homage to the building's storied history, with a color palette inspired by Russian and Greek religious icons, hand-painted trompe l'oeil inspired credenzas, and more than 700 antiques sourced from Europe by the hoteliers. hotelpeterandpaul.com.
